You have heard of  PUSH EMAIL and some of you could have used it.  The Diamond2 comes with PUSH INTERNET.  Hey, that’s a new word.  Push Internet is good for people who want to follow the share market or weather forcast or whatever that get updated all the time.  In Push Internet, the web information are pre-loaded and when you access them, it comes to you like instant noodles.  No waiting, it’s Internet-on-tap.   I will love this feature as I do not like to wait and I can get the information I need without waiting for it to load.

All you need to do is to set your phone to download the information.  With Push Internet you get WHAT you want, you get WHEN you want it and you also get to set HOW often you want it to update.  Though it is called PUSH INTERNET, it is more like Pull Internet working underneath.

This feature is added by HTC in the browser tab.
